导读:本文将介绍MySQL数据库中两表的级联删除操作,包括实现步骤、数据库操作及总结 。
1. 实现步骤:
MySQL数据库中两表的级联删除,是指在一个表中的某条记录被删除时,另一个表中相关联的记录也会被同时删除,以保证数据的一致性和完整性 。要实现两表的级联删除,需要在其中一个表上设置外键 , 并在外键上设置ON DELETE CASCADE,这样当该表中的数据被删除时,另一个表中的数据也会被自动删除 。
2. 数据库操作:
例如有两个表A和B,A表中有一个字段id,而B表中有一个字段a_id , 其中a_id是A表中id的外键,要实现A表中记录被删除时,B表中相关联的记录也被同时删除,可以使用以下SQL语句:
ALTER TABLE B
ADD FOREIGN KEY (a_id)
REFERENCES A(id)
ON DELETE CASCADE;
3. 总结:
【mysql删除多个表 mysql两表的级联删除】MySQL数据库中两表的级联删除是在一个表中的某条记录被删除时,另一个表中相关联的记录也会被同时删除,以保证数据的一致性和完整性 。实现此操作需要在其中一个表上设置外键,并在外键上设置ON DELETE CASCADE,然后执行SQL语句即可实现两表的级联删除操作 。
- mysql游标和存储过程是什么 mysql游标表名为变量
- 如何使用cmd命令行提示符登录mysql服务器 cmd中登陆mysql
- mysql怎么设置时区 mysql时间显示设置
- 招聘要精通mysql
- mysql 65535 8192 限制 mysql限制资源使用
- mysql有topn
- mysql协议包解析 mysqlicp协议
- mysql子查询和连接查询 mysql子查询插入
- Mysql使用索引查询 mysql使用round
- mysql下到了c盘 mysql怎么不存到c盘
